Understanding Common AC Issues:
Air conditioners are complex systems with various components that can encounter problems over time. By familiarizing yourself with common AC issues, you’ll be better prepared to identify and resolve them promptly.
1. Insufficient Cooling:
One of the most common problems homeowners face is an AC unit that fails to cool the space adequately. This issue may arise due to a dirty air filter, clogged condenser coils, or low refrigerant levels. Regularly cleaning or replacing air filters and scheduling routine maintenance can help prevent this problem.
2. Frequent Cycling:
If your air conditioner turns on and off frequently, it could be a sign of an underlying issue. The culprit may be a malfunctioning thermostat, improper refrigerant charge, or a faulty compressor. Consulting a professional AC technician is essential to diagnose and rectify the problem correctly.
3. Strange Noises:
Unusual noises emanating from your air conditioner can be alarming. Buzzing, rattling, or squealing sounds may indicate loose parts, worn-out belts, or a failing motor. It’s crucial not to ignore these noises, as they can worsen over time and potentially lead to expensive repairs.
Maintenance Tips to Keep Your AC in Top Shape:
Regular maintenance is key to keeping your AC unit running smoothly and avoiding costly repairs. Here are some essential tips to maintain your air conditioner:
1. Clean or Replace Air Filters:
Clogged air filters restrict airflow, reducing your AC’s efficiency and putting strain on the system. Clean or replace filters every one to three months, depending on usage, to ensure proper airflow and improve indoor air quality.
2. Keep the Outdoor Unit Clean:
The outdoor unit houses the condenser coils, and any dirt or debris buildup can obstruct airflow and hamper performance. Regularly clean the unit and ensure there are no obstructions such as leaves or vegetation nearby.
3. Check and Clean the Evaporator Coils:
Over time, evaporator coils can accumulate dirt and dust, hindering heat transfer. Inspect the coils annually and clean them if necessary. Consider hiring a professional for a thorough cleaning to prevent damage.
4. Maintain Proper Airflow:
Ensure that vents and registers are not obstructed by furniture, curtains, or rugs. Restricted airflow can strain your AC system and result in reduced cooling efficiency.
